数据库投影设计图例是什么

fiy 其他 1

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库投影设计图例是数据库设计过程中的一种图形表示方法,用于展示数据库中各个实体、属性和关系之间的关系和结构。它是数据库设计师用来沟通和传达数据库设计意图的重要工具。

    数据库投影设计图例通常包括以下几个要素:

    1. 实体:实体是数据库中的一个具体对象,如人、物、地点等。在数据库投影设计图例中,实体通常用矩形表示,并在矩形上标注实体的名称。

    2. 属性:属性是实体的特征或描述,如人的姓名、年龄、性别等。在数据库投影设计图例中,属性通常用椭圆形表示,并与相应的实体连接。

    3. 关系:关系是实体之间的连接和交互方式,用于描述实体之间的联系。在数据库投影设计图例中,关系通常用菱形表示,并与相应的实体连接。

    4. 主键:主键是实体中唯一标识一个实体的属性,用于确保实体在数据库中的唯一性。在数据库投影设计图例中,主键通常用下划线标注,并与相应的实体属性连接。

    5. 外键:外键是实体中引用其他实体的属性,用于建立实体之间的关联关系。在数据库投影设计图例中,外键通常用虚线表示,并与相应的实体关系连接。

    通过数据库投影设计图例,数据库设计师可以清晰地展示数据库中的各个实体、属性和关系之间的关系和结构,方便沟通和理解数据库设计意图,为后续的数据库开发和维护工作提供指导和参考。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库投影设计图例是一种用于表示数据库结构和关系的图表。它主要用于展示数据库中的表、字段和它们之间的关系,以及表之间的外键约束。数据库投影设计图例通常包括以下几个方面的内容:

    1. 表示实体的矩形框:每个实体在图例中都用一个矩形框表示,矩形框内包含实体的名称。例如,一个学生实体可以表示为一个矩形框,矩形框中写有“学生”。

    2. 字段的表示:在实体的矩形框内,列出该实体的所有字段。每个字段都用一行表示,通常包括字段的名称和数据类型。例如,一个学生实体可能有字段“学号”和“姓名”,它们分别表示为两行,每行包含字段名称和数据类型。

    3. 主键的标识:在实体的矩形框内,用一个下划线标识主键字段。主键字段是用来唯一标识实体的字段,通常在图例中用加粗或下划线表示。

    4. 外键的表示:如果一个实体与另一个实体存在外键关系,可以使用箭头表示这种关系。箭头指向被引用的实体,表示外键指向被引用实体的主键。例如,如果学生实体有一个外键字段“班级ID”,指向班级实体的主键字段“班级ID”,那么在图例中可以用箭头从学生实体指向班级实体。

    5. 表之间的关系:如果表之间存在关系,可以使用线条表示这种关系。常见的关系有一对一关系、一对多关系和多对多关系。一对一关系可以用一条直线表示,一对多关系可以用一个箭头指向多的一方,多对多关系可以用一个菱形表示。

    通过数据库投影设计图例,可以清晰地展示数据库中的表、字段和它们之间的关系,有助于开发人员和数据库管理员理解和设计数据库结构。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库投影设计图例是数据库设计的一种可视化工具,用于描述数据库中表之间的关系和属性。它是一个图形表示,提供了数据库模式的结构和组成部分的视觉概述。

    数据库投影设计图例通常包含以下内容:

    1. 表格(Entities):图例中的每个表格代表数据库中的一个实体,例如用户、订单、产品等。每个表格通常包含实体的名称和主键。

    2. 属性(Attributes):每个表格中的列代表实体的属性。属性描述了实体的特征和信息。例如,在用户表中,属性可以是用户ID、姓名、地址等。

    3. 主键(Primary Key):主键是用于唯一标识实体的属性或属性组合。在图例中,主键通常用特殊标记(如下划线或星号)表示。

    4. 外键(Foreign Key):外键是用于建立表格之间关系的属性。它在一个表格中引用另一个表格的主键。在图例中,外键通常用箭头表示。

    5. 关系(Relationships):图例中的箭头表示表格之间的关系。关系可以是一对一、一对多或多对多。箭头的方向指示关系的方向。

    6. 约束(Constraints):约束是对数据库中数据的限制和规定。在图例中,常见的约束可以是唯一约束、非空约束等。

    7. 索引(Indexes):索引用于提高数据库查询的性能。在图例中,索引通常用特殊标记(如斜杠或星号)表示。

    通过数据库投影设计图例,可以清晰地了解数据库的结构,包括表之间的关系、属性和约束。它是数据库设计过程中的重要工具,能够帮助开发人员和数据库管理员理解和沟通数据库结构。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部